Biography:
Clifford A. Beyler is a partner in the law firm of Hall, Render, Killian, Heath & Lyman, P.C. Cliff is in the Government Relations and Regulatory section of the firm which also as General Counsel to the Indiana Hospital Association.

Prior to joining the firm, Cliff was employed with Indiana State Department of Health for over 10 years and served as Director of Medical Care Administration. As a member of the firm's health law group, he focuses on Medicare and Accreditation regulatory and compliance matters as they affect hospitals and other health care entities. His areas of expertise include special regulatory problems of EMTALA, risk management and quality assurance issues, licensure and Medicare/Medicaid certification, CLIA, and other health care delivery systems.

Mr. Beyler received his B.A. in chemistry from Indiana University - Indianapolis in 1974 and his J.D. from Indiana University, Indianapolis, in 1983. He is a member of the American Health Lawyers Association. He is also licensed to practice law in Indiana and Michigan and is admitted to practice law in the U.S. District Courts: Northern and Southern Districts of Indiana.
